Transaction 61c8a470b9737e5798143019baff9ea53909cf07c1ff2564aebc3dc092192ecc
1 Input
1 Output
-
61c8a470b9737e5798143019baff9ea53909cf07c1ff2564aebc3dc092192ecc:0
- value
- 1780829
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d04291abcb4a881aa2620430a4486cdaa792a71f OP_EQUAL
- address
- 3LgCDjy26BMAwb49PuqND3HWoWCUup4cyT